The Tetrasulfide,bis(dibutoxyphosphinothioyl) (9CI), with the CAS registry number of 42169-95-9, is also known as Bis(dibutoxyphosphinothioyl) tetrasulphide. Its EINECS registry number is 255-692-9. Its molecular formula is C16H36O4P2S6 and molecular weight is 546.792162. What's more, its IUPAC name is Dibutoxy-(dibutoxyphosphinothioyltetrasulfanyl)-sulfanylidene-$l^{5}-phosphane.
Physical properties about the Tetrasulfide,bis(dibutoxyphosphinothioyl) (9CI) are: (1)ACD/LogP: 10.16; (2)# of Rule of 5 Violations: 2; (3)ACD/LogD (pH 5.5): 10.16; (4)ACD/LogD (pH 7.4): 10.16; (5)#H bond acceptors: 4; (6)#H bond donors: 0; (7)#Freely Rotating Bonds: 21; (8)Polar Surface Area: 221.92 Å2; (9)Index of Refraction: 1.568; (10)Molar Refractivity: 143.41 cm3; (11)Molar Volume: 438 cm3; (12)Surface Tension: 52.1 dyne/cm; (13)Density: 1.248 g/cm3; (14)Flash Point: 291.7 °C; (15)Enthalpy of Vaporization: 80.94 kJ/mol; (16)Boiling Point: 558.7 °C at 760 mmHg; (17)Vapour Pressure: 6.11E-12 mmHg at 25 °C.
Uses: it is used to produce other chemicals. For example, it is used to produce C13H28NO2PS4. This reaction needs solvent Diethyl ether. The yield is about 82 %.
